Kilojoule to Terawatt-hour Conversion Formula
One Kilojoule is equal to 2.777778e-13 Terawatt-hour.
Formula: 1 kJ = 2.777778e-13 Terawatt-hour

What is Energy?
Energy is the capacity of a physical system to do work or produce heat. The SI unit is the joule (J), defined as the work done when a force of one newton is applied over one metre (1 J = 1 N·m = 1 kg·m²/s²). Other important units include the kilowatt-hour (kWh)—used on electricity bills (1 kWh = 3.6 MJ)—the calorie (cal)—used in nutrition (1 food Calorie = 1 kcal = 4,184 J)—and the electronvolt (eV), used in atomic and particle physics (1 eV = 1.602 × 10⁻¹⁹ J).
What is Kilojoule?
The kilojoule (kJ) is an SI-derived unit of energy equal to 1,000 joules (J). It is widely used to measure mechanical work, heat, electrical energy, chemical energy, and food energy. The kilojouleis commonly used in science, engineering, and nutrition because it expresses larger energy values more conveniently than the joule.
What is Terawatt-hour?
A terawatt-hour (symbol: TWh) is a unit of energy equal to the amount of energy produced or consumed at a constant power of one terawatt for one hour. One terawatt-hour is exactly 3.6 × 1015 joules. Terawatt-hours are widely used in the electricity industry, national energy statistics, renewable energy planning, and power system analysis to express very large quantities of electrical energy.
Because one terawatt-hour represents an enormous amount of energy, it is commonly used to report the annual electricity generation or consumption of countries, regions, utility companies, and large power plants. Smaller electrical energy quantities are typically measured in watt-hours (Wh), kilowatt-hours (kWh), megawatt-hours (MWh), or gigawatt-hours (GWh).
Terawatt-hours are frequently used to compare electricity production from renewable sources such as solar, wind, and hydropower, as well as fossil fuel and nuclear power plants. Although the watt is an SI-derived unit of power, the watt-hour is accepted for use with the SI and remains the standard unit for measuring electrical energy in the power industry.
